10 Small Dining Room Ideas to Make the Most of Your Space

1. Utilize vertical space: When working with a small dining room, it's important to think vertically. Consider adding floating shelves or a tall bookshelf to store dishes, glasses, and other dining essentials.

2. Choose a round table: A round table takes up less space than a square or rectangular one, making it a great option for a small dining room. It also creates a more intimate and cozy atmosphere.

3. Invest in multi-functional furniture: Look for dining tables with built-in storage or expandable options to save space. You can also consider using a bench as seating, which can be tucked under the table when not in use.

4. Use mirrors: Mirrors can help create the illusion of a larger space. Hang a large mirror on one wall or use smaller mirrors to reflect light and make the room feel more open.

5. Opt for a light color palette: Light colors, such as white, cream, or pastels, can make a room feel more spacious. Use these colors on walls, furniture, and decor to create a bright and airy atmosphere.

6. Keep it simple: Avoid cluttering your small dining room with too many pieces of furniture or decor. Stick to the essentials and keep the space clean and uncluttered.

7. Consider a built-in banquette: A built-in banquette, or bench seating, can save space by eliminating the need for chairs. It can also provide hidden storage underneath for extra dining essentials.

8. Hang pendant lights: Instead of using table lamps or floor lamps, consider hanging pendant lights above your dining table. This will free up floor space and add an elegant touch to the room.

9. Create a designated dining area: If your dining room is part of an open floor plan, create a designated dining area by using a rug or different flooring material. This will help define the space and make it feel separate from the rest of the room.

10. Keep it cozy: Just because your dining room is small, doesn't mean it can't be inviting and cozy. Add some soft textiles, such as a plush rug or throw pillows, to make the space feel warm and welcoming.

Small Dining Room Layout Ideas for Every Shape and Size

Whether you have a square, rectangular, or oddly-shaped dining room, there are layout ideas that can work for your space. Here are a few suggestions:

- Square rooms: A square room can benefit from a round or square dining table placed in the center. This will create a symmetrical and balanced look.

- Rectangular rooms: A rectangular room can accommodate a longer dining table placed against one of the longer walls. You can also consider a banquette or bench seating along the shorter walls.

- Oddly-shaped rooms: For oddly-shaped dining rooms, consider a flexible layout with a small round table or a mix of different seating options to make the most of the space.

Maximizing Square Footage in a Small Dining Room

In order to make the most of your small dining room, it's important to maximize every square foot. Here are some ways to do this:

- Use wall-mounted shelves or cabinets to free up floor space.

- Consider a drop-leaf table that can be folded down when not in use.

- Use a bar cart for additional storage and serving space.

- Hang a folding table on the wall that can be pulled down when needed.

How to Measure and Calculate Square Footage for a Small Dining Room

Before designing or decorating a small dining room, it's important to know the exact square footage of the space. Here's how to measure and calculate it:

- Measure the length and width of the room in feet using a measuring tape.

- Multiply the length by the width to get the total square footage.

- If the room is an irregular shape, divide it into smaller sections and calculate the square footage for each section, then add them together for the total.
